And here is the story Jolene sent me!  And yes I DID love to paint her!
My friend Kristin sent me your email and I gasped, because I am a fan of your work and attend the Deviant Art show to support A Rotta Love Plus. I would just love if you picked Shiloh for your 30 dogs project.
Long story short, I'm a single working mom who only ever had fluffy little dogs until I started doing some volunteer work for local dog rescues and fell in love with "pit bull" dogs. So overlooked, so misunderstood, so many being killed right here in Minneapolis for the crime of having a blocky-shaped head. When I saw a picture of a very shy pit bull mix dog, 9 months old, fearfully plastered in the corner of her kennel at Minneapolis Animal Care and Control, I knew she was mine and I was able to adopt her through Secondhand Hounds. Shiloh is still shy, but improving after a couple of years with us. She even earned her Canine Good Citizen title through ARLP. She is now a beloved family member and sleeps with my daughter every night. Because of her, I have become active in working to improve policies at MACC to level the playing field for all dogs - this is how I met Rachel and Michelle at ARLP. Dogs like Shiloh deserve a CHANCE. 
Shiloh is a lovely deep espresso brown and has a goofy grin and little white toe tips, wouldn't you love to paint her? :)
